#include "artclass.h"
#include <cmath>
int style(int H,int W,int R[500][500],int G[500][500],int B[500][500])
{
double diff=0,border=0;
int i,j;
for(i=0;i<H;i++)for(j=1;j<W;j++)diff+=pow(R[i][j]-R[i][j-1],2)+pow(G[i][j]-G[i][j-1],2)+pow(B[i][j]-B[i][j-1],2);
for(i=0;i<H;i++)for(j=1;j<W;j++)if(pow(R[i][j]-R[i][j-1],2)+pow(G[i][j]-G[i][j-1],2)+pow(B[i][j]-B[i][j-1],2)>diff/W/H)border+=1;
diff=sqrt(diff/W/H)/45;
border=border/W/H;
if(diff<0.25)return 4;
if(diff>0.96)return 3;
if(border>0.18)return 2;
return 1;
}
